Titanium(IV) chloride at 150  K

A. Dawson, A. Parkin, S. Parsons, C. R. Pulham and A. L. C. Young

Abstract: Titanium(IV) chloride, TiCl4, is an air-sensitive liquid under ambient conditions. The crystal structure consists of tetrahedral molecules weakly associated in pairs, and is isostructural with tin(IV) bromide.
